Control of chaos in a dual-ring erbium-doped fiber laser is studied by modulating the laser pump and its physical model is presented to induce the dual-ring erbium-doped fiber laser to a cyclic state and other dynamics states via adding a periodic signal to the pump. When one pump is modulated by a periodic square wave signal, we find that chaotic behaviors of the laser can be pressured and the dual-ring can show two periodic states while each ring can emit cyclic pulses. It indicates that chaotic dual-ring erbium-doped fiber laser has been controlled. When another periodic square wave signal with a different modulation depth value is used to perform on the laser, behavior of the laser can be deduced to produce multi-periodic states. When the pump is modulated by a sinusoidal signal, behaviors of the laser can be controlled to deduce two other periodic states while each ring emits cyclic pulses. We find that chaotic behavior of the laser can be controlled. And the laser shows a lot of dynamics behaviors via the chaos-control method. The result is very helpful to study of chaos-control techniques, fiber lasers and other lasers.
